Taxes

Oh for fucks sake. I finally got around to calculating my hourly wage after taking out taxes. I only get to keep 67% of what I gross an hour.

I'm now even more angry than usual about not having universal health care....because if I calculate my health insurance premiums on the 10k deductible policy I'm currently carrying into my hourly wage, it's even more depressing. If I fall off a ladder, I'm screwed any way you look at it.

I'm technically self employed, at least as far as the IRS knows. I work for a company that gives us 1099's, not 1040s. Yet we're all told what time to show up, when to leave, and we're generally expected to behave as employees. Yet we have to carry our own contractor insurance, pay self employment taxes, etc.

The boss is renting a boat for 3 hours this Thursday as an employee appreciation event. There will be water skiing and beer. We were told to bring 10 bucks a person to cover said boat and beer. At the appreciation event. I feel appreciated.....

My new Truck



So, I bought a truck last weekend.... It's adorable! It's a 1971 Chevy c10 stepside, with an oak strip bed and curvy wheelwells, just like I've always wanted.


It's almost entirely stock, including the original 250 inline 6 engine. Most of the parts are new/rebuilt. There are only two spots of rust I need to worry about, and the entire panel one of them is on can be replaced for $17.99.








I replaced an exhaust flange gasket the other day. It cost $2.18 and fit all Chevy/GMC models from 1937-1987.

The only thing wrong with it that I know of is the throwout bearing in the clutch. While I'm under there with the transmission and driveshaft dropped to fix it, I'll just replace the whole clutch. (It'll need it sooner rather than later). A complete clutch kit cost $155. The shop down the road had two of them in stock.


My van was a big hit with women and small children. Now that I have this truck, I'm a huge hit with the men, especially guys who are old enough to have driven a 70's era truck back in the day.

I'm going to paint and reupholster, and redo the wood in the bed. I'm hoping for enough leftover massaranduba from the jobsite to use for the bed. Nothing like Brazilian hardwood to make it look pretty. :-)
